Product revenue, net for the three and six months ended June 30, 2023, consisted of net product sales of BRIUMVI in the U.S., which was commercially launched in late January 2023. Product revenue, net for the three and six months ended June 30, 2022, consisted of net product sales of UKONIQTM (umbralisib), which was withdrawn from the U.S. market in May of 2022. ​ ● R&D Expenses: Total research and development (R&D) expense was $28.1 million and $44.0 million for the three and six months ended June 30, 2023, compared to $26.9 million and $74.9 million for the three and six months ended June 30, 2022. (the “Company”) and its wholly-owned subsidiary TG Biologics, Inc. entered into a Commercialization Agreement (the “Agreement”) with Neuraxpharm Pharmaceuticals, S.L. (“Neuraxpharm”), pursuant to which the Company granted Neuraxpharm an exclusive license to commercialize BRIUMVI ® (ublituximab) for relapsing forms of multiple sclerosis (“RMS”) in Europe and certain other territories outside the United States (collectively, the “Territory”), excluding Canada and Mexico, which are retained by the Company, and certain Asian countries previously partnered. ​ Under the terms of the Agreement, Neuraxpharm is obligated to use commercially reasonable efforts to launch and commercialize BRIUMVI in the Territory, including maintaining current marketing authorizations, and obtaining additional marketing authorizations for BRIUMVI in the Territory, in accordance with a commercialization plan.
